About Black Voice Foundation

The Black Voice Foundation is a nonprofit organization dedicated to educating and empowering underserved communities through media, history, and educational programs. Founded in 1988 by publishers Hardy and Cheryl Brown, the Foundation emerged from the legacy of Black Voice News, a pioneering African American newspaper established in 1972 in Riverside, California.

Our History

The Foundation was created in 1988 as a nonprofit organization dedicated to educating and empowering underserved communities through media, history, and educational programs. It has played a crucial role in preserving African American history, particularly through initiatives like the Footsteps to Freedom Underground Railroad Study Tour, which educates participants on the historical routes of the Underground Railroad.

The Foundation has also focused on developing future generations of journalists and leaders through internships, mentorship, and training programs, such as the Black Voice News Internship Program. By bridging the gap between history and contemporary issues, the Black Voice Foundation continues to honor the Browns' commitment to social justice, education, and community empowerment. 



The Black Voice Foundation is currently engaged in preserving the Black Voice News Archives, ensuring that decades of Black history remain accessible for future generations. The Foundation also fiscally sponsors Mapping Black California, a data-driven initiative mapping the Black experience, and actively promotes solutions journalism through events and projects that address critical community issues with an eye toward actionable solutions.
